Transaction 873e36c3a6f462e6f5e71dfd895c2d1755498488c783108f50e20d9cc507d2c5

5 Input
1 Outputs
  • 873e36c3a6f462e6f5e71dfd895c2d1755498488c783108f50e20d9cc507d2c5:0
  • value  3515654
    address  1NFxyLWsBzLyViSChgPQynfC93Ypn2ED6i